Undocumented adoptions, often referred to as Low-Paternal Events (NPE), don’t necessarily mean you to grandma was unfaithful. In reality, the best cause of Undocumented Adoptions is the fact that spouse from a lady having a baby or one or two passes away, she remarries, along with her small kids try raised with the step-dad’s past label. Such “adoptions” was public knowledge at that time, and have been really common.

Mothers often died or other family or often residents took the youngsters. Which records is missing in the long run, therefore now, we find these types of occurrences using DNA and they feel, so you can united states, undocumented adoptions. During the time, it was not some thing unique, without you to most likely even discussed it. Such events was indeed prevalent and additionally they indeed weren’t wonders. We can often find suggestions of these occurrences using the census and you can viewing other records for example demise suggestions, wills and you can obituaries very carefully, sometimes for glaring omissions.
